Haenyeo of Yeongrak-ri, Kylie 17.06.2026

Originally from New York, Kylie came to Korea in 2012 as an English teacher and later moved to Jeju in 2016. While working in tourism and education on the island, she became interested in learning more about haenyeo culture and joined Hansupul Haenyeo School. In 2024, she officially began diving as a haenyeo in Yeongrak-ri. Although she initially struggled with the equipment and the Jeju dialect,...

Recording Haenyeo, ko myeong hyo 18.02.2026

She is a haenyeo in her sixth year of diving at Iho Tewoo Beach, documenting the landscapes of Jeju both above and below the sea with a camera attached to her tewak. While diving, she has continuously recorded marine life and the everyday rhythms of the haenyeo community, paying particular attention to the lives of elder haenyeo, including her mother. Jung Boram – Farmer of Mokhwaoreum 28.01.2026

Jung Boram worked in the fashion and clothing industry in Seoul for over ten years. Seeking possibilities beyond industry-driven fashion, he moved to Jeju to explore clothing made in closer relationship with nature.
